Leading foreign investors continue to demonstrate strong confidence in Pakistan’s economic potential, with OICCI member companies alone investing over USD 23 billion in the country over the past decade, surpassing Pakistan’s cumulative net foreign direct investment (FDI) inflows of USD 21 billion during the same period. The findings, released in OICCI’s Members’ Contribution to the Economy 2025 report on Monday, reflect the sustained commitment of OICCI members to expanding their operations, reinvesting earnings and supporting Pakistan’s long-term economic development. Lucky Investments Limited (“Lucky Investments”) has been awarded AM1, the highest Asset Manager Rating by the Pakistan Credit Rating Agency Limited (PACRA), marking a historic milestone for the Company less than one and a half years after commencing operations in April 2025. The AM1 rating reflects PACRA’s highest opinion of an asset manager’s quality, recognizing exceptional standards of governance, investment management, risk management, operational excellence, internal controls, financial strength, and institutional capability. The Board of Directors of Meezan Bank, in their meeting approved the financial statements of the Bank for the half year ended June 30, 2026. The meeting was chaired by Mr. Riyadh S.A.A. Edrees – Chairman of the Board. The Bank reported a Profit After Tax (PAT) of Rs 48.88 billion, achieving an annualised Return on Equity of 34.7%, reflecting its ongoing commitment to enhancing shareholder value. Karandaaz Pakistan has entered into a partnership with Kissan Gudam, a venture of the Hajisons Group, providing funding and strategic support designed to strengthen Pakistan’s farming communities and modernise the agricultural ecosystem. By unifying modern storage infrastructure, digital financial services, and direct market access into a single seamless platform, the collaboration will help smallholder farmers protect their yields, access fair credit through Electronic Warehouse Receipt (EWR)-based financing, and secure sustainable livelihoods — while reducing post-harvest losses, boosting market transparency, and bringing farmers into the formal financial ecosystem. The UBL National Innovation Hackathon 2026 concluded at the National Incubation Center (NIC) Karachi after a three-day innovation challenge that brought together 25 finalist teams selected from 1,281 applicants across Pakistan. Organized by NIC Karachi, an Ignite-funded initiative under the Ministry of IT & Telecom, in collaboration with United Bank Limited (UBL), the hackathon focused on developing technology-driven solutions for Pakistan’s banking, payments, and financial services sector. Participants competed across five thematic areas: Artificial Intelligence in Banking, Blockchain & Digital Trust, UX/UI for Inclusive Financial Services, Open Banking APIs, and Emerging FinTech Solutions. The Aga Khan University (AKU) has launched the AKU Manual of Pediatrics, a free, locally developed clinical resource created “by clinicians, for clinicians” to support the diagnosis and management of common childhood conditions in Pakistan. Developed in collaboration with AKU’s Department of Paediatrics and Child Health, the manual provides evidence-based guidance for pediatricians, family physicians, medical officers, residents, and other healthcare professionals and is available free through the AKU Manual website and mobile application. Wafi Energy Pakistan Limited inaugurated a 7.4 million litre motor gasoline storage tank at its Tarru Jabba terminal in Nowshera,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. This newly constructed facility expands Pakistan’s fuel storage infrastructure and marks company’s latest investment in Pakistan’s energy industry. As Pakistan’s energy needs continue to grow, this new storage tank strengthens reliability of fuel supply for customers, including on major travel routes to the country’s tourism destinations. The inauguration ceremony was attended by representatives from the Oil and Gas Regulatory Authority (OGRA), led by Sohail Ahmed Tariq, Senior Executive Director (Enforcement), OGRA, alongside Wafi Energy Pakistan’s team.
